The australian finger lime is a native citrus variety that is found growing as an understory shrub or tree in the rainforests of Southeast Queensland and Northern New South Wales.

Citrus trees can only be shipped to florida. The finger lime tree produces small but unique citrus fruits that are packed with flavor and juice. It can grow as a dense hedge, or even a manageable container species, a small tree, depending on your preference and gardening goals. This species of citrus is known for its hardiness and adaptability, making it an excellent choice for gardeners looking to grow something a bit more exotic. To grow australian finger limes, it's best to start with grafted stock or semi-hardwood cuttings, as these will produce hardier and more rapid-growing trees.

Generic #ad - Soil: finger lime can grow in a wide range of soil types as long as it is well-draining. They prefer loamy soils with high organic matter. For optimal growth, the soil pH should be slightly acidic to neutral.

Do not over-fertilize during bloom and fruit development because it may cause the flowers and fruit to drop. Sun: finger limes thrive in dappled light as well as full sun. Water: water in the morning once or twice a week. Soaker hoses or drip irrigation should be used for irrigating to avoid water runoff. Expected blooming period: Flowering from March to July, harvest from November to March. Planting suggestions: fertilize finger limes in the spring and summer. Soil should be kept moist, but not soggy or saturated.
